Recognising Problem Gambling

Gambling-related harm can affect anyone. It may develop gradually, and it is not always easy to identify in the moment. Recognising early warning signs can help you take corrective action sooner.

Potential indicators of problem gambling may include:

  • Spending more time or money than intended, and finding it difficult to stop.
  • Chasing losses by increasing stakes or playing longer to “win back” money.
  • Gambling when stressed, upset, bored, or under pressure.
  • Borrowing money, selling possessions, or missing bill payments due to gambling.
  • Hiding gambling activity from family, friends, or colleagues.
  • Feeling guilt, anxiety, or irritability connected to gambling results.
  • Neglecting work, study, relationships, or daily responsibilities.

If any of these feel familiar, consider using the tools described below and contacting an independent support service for confidential guidance.

Self-Assessment and Limits

Self-assessment is a practical way to reflect on whether gambling remains enjoyable and controlled. You can ask yourself simple questions: Am I gambling within a budget? Do I feel in control? Am I gambling to escape problems? Would I feel comfortable if someone close to me saw my play history?

Setting limits can help reduce impulsive decisions. Depending on what is available in your account settings at Winshark Casino, you may be able to use one or more of the following options:

  • Deposit limits to cap the amount you can add to your account within a chosen period.
  • Loss limits to restrict further play once losses reach a set threshold.
  • Reality checks to receive periodic reminders about time spent and activity while logged in.
  • Cooling-off periods to take a short break from gambling for a defined timeframe.
  • Self-exclusion to block access for a longer period when you need a more decisive stop.

Limits are most effective when set in advance and kept consistent. Choose figures that are realistic for your personal circumstances, and avoid increasing limits in response to losses or frustration.

Parental Controls

Parents and guardians can take practical steps to help prevent minors from accessing gambling content online. Device-level and network-level controls can be particularly effective when combined with active supervision and open conversations about online risks.

Suggested steps include:

  • Use operating system parental controls to restrict adult content and manage app or browser access.
  • Create separate user profiles on shared devices and protect adult profiles with strong passwords.
  • Enable content filters and safe search features on browsers and search engines.
  • Consider using reputable filtering software to block gambling-related websites.
  • Do not save payment details on shared devices and review app permissions regularly.

These measures can reduce the likelihood of underage access, but no single tool is perfect. Regular review of settings is recommended, especially after software updates.

Tips for Staying in Control

Responsible gambling habits are easiest to maintain when they are part of your routine. The suggestions below are intended to help you keep play balanced and to reduce the chance of making decisions based on impulse or emotion.

  • Set a clear entertainment budget and treat it like any other leisure expense.
  • Decide on a time limit before you start playing and stop when that time ends.
  • Avoid gambling when tired, upset, stressed, or under the influence of alcohol or drugs.
  • Do not chase losses; accept that losing is a normal possible outcome of gambling.
  • Take regular breaks and use reminders or alarms to stay aware of time spent.
  • Keep gambling separate from money needed for rent, bills, food, or savings goals.
  • Review your account activity periodically to understand your spending patterns.
  • Balance gambling with other hobbies and social activities to avoid over-focus on play.
  • If you find yourself increasing stakes to get the same excitement, consider taking a break.

If you feel you are losing control despite these steps, using cooling-off or self-exclusion can provide immediate structure while you seek independent support.
